> I see occasional failures (1 out of ~20) on branch 0.94 of TestSplitLogWorker#testAcquireTaskAtStartup
> {noformat}
> Running org.apache.hadoop.hbase.regionserver.TestSplitLogWorker
> Tests run: 5, Failures: 1, Errors: 0, Skipped: 0, Time elapsed: 4.737 sec <<< FAILURE!
> Failed tests:
>     testAcquireTaskAtStartup(org.apache.hadoop.hbase.regionserver.TestSplitLogWorker): ctr=0, oldval=0, newval=1
> {noformat}
> Bisecting commits on 0.94 branch, using (up to) 50 repetitions to include or exclude, I get:
> {noformat}
> 8cc5a5f481aeaf6debfa95110c4392d9c3ea20ca is the first bad commit
> commit 8cc5a5f481aeaf6debfa95110c4392d9c3ea20ca
>     HBASE-7172 TestSplitLogManager.testVanishingTaskZNode() fails when run individually and is flaky
>     git-svn-id: https://svn.apache.org/repos/asf/hbase/branches/0.94@1414975 13f79535-47bb-0310-9956-ffa450edef68
> {noformat}
> Will try again to see if the search ends in the same place.
